Lara Gut-Behrami Faces Career Threat After Training Crash
The world of alpine skiing is holding its breath as Swiss star Lara Gut-Behrami is facing a potentially career-ending injury following a severe fall during training in the United States. Reports emerging from her camp suggest a significant knee injury, sparking fears that the 32-year-old’s illustrious career may be prematurely over. The incident has sent shockwaves through the skiing community, with fans and fellow athletes alike expressing concern for the Olympic medalist.
Gut-Behrami, a consistent contender on the World Cup circuit and a 2023 World Champion in giant slalom, suffered the injury while preparing for upcoming competitions. Details surrounding the exact nature of the fall remain limited, but initial assessments point to a serious ligament tear. Several sources, including Sportnet and Športky.sk, indicate the injury is severe enough to jeopardize her participation in future events, and potentially, her entire career.
Gut-Behrami’s Illustrious Career: A Retrospective
Lara Gut-Behrami’s career has been defined by resilience and exceptional talent. Emerging as a force in alpine skiing over a decade ago, she quickly established herself as a consistent threat in all disciplines. Her breakthrough came with a World Cup victory in slalom in 2012, signaling the arrival of a future champion. She has since accumulated numerous World Cup wins, a World Championship title, and an Olympic bronze medal, cementing her status as one of Switzerland’s most decorated skiers.
Known for her aggressive and dynamic style, Gut-Behrami has overcome significant setbacks throughout her career, including a serious knee injury in 2017. Her ability to recover and return to the top level of competition has been a testament to her unwavering determination and dedication. This latest injury, however, presents a challenge unlike any she has faced before, given her age and the potential severity of the damage.
